Hello
So I have a 2006 VW Beetle convertible and lately some weird things have been happening... I cant afford to get it looked at right now so I figured I would ask everyone on here to see if it helps me.
1. When I unlock my car the windows automatically go down that half inch to clear the top when I open the door but randomly the driver side window will go up that half inch while my door is open. I have to hit the unlock button on my key and then close it really quickly before it goes up on its own. It isnt at a specific time at all so I never know when it is going to happen.
2. In the morning when i get in my car the coolant light will flash red and make 3 beeping noises. When i looked in the manual it said that it means the car is overheating and i need to turn the car off. It has been 30-40 degrees in the morning so I dont understand how it could be overheating in the freezing cold when i havent even driven it yet. After about 2 min of it flashing red the light switches to a stationary blue and then about 30 min after that the light goes off completely
If anyone could help me out and clear up some things that would be great. I know these are probably really stupid questions but I cant afford to pay someone to look at it right now.

Welcome to the forum.
Well its going to cost your either way, There are very few simple solutions to electrical problems on VW's apart from checking all connections are good. You need to find someone with VAG-COM\VCDS to do a scan for any error code, they can also operate different systems to see if they work correctly.
